Nicaragua`s power device analyzer import market saw a significant shift in 2024, with top exporters being Slovenia, China, Malaysia, USA, and India. The market concentration increased from low to moderate, indicating a more balanced distribution among suppliers. The impressive CAGR of 12.3% from 2020 to 2024 highlights the sustained growth in demand for these devices. Moreover, the growth rate of 12.24% from 2023 to 2024 suggests a continued upward trajectory. This data points to a dynamic and expanding market for power device analyzers in Nicaragua, presenting opportunities for both domestic and international suppliers.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
